Subject: [PATCH] tg3: Don't turn off led on 5719 serdes port 0

commit 989038e217e94161862a959e82f9a1ecf8dda152 upstream.

Turning off led on port 0 of the 5719 serdes causes all other ports to
lose power and stop functioning. Add tg3_phy_led_bug() function to check
for this condition. We use a switch() in tg3_phy_led_bug() for
consistency with the tg3_phy_power_bug() function.
